Akademisk Boldklub A/S announces the departure of winger and right-back, Steven Simpson. Simpson has decided to make use of the clause in his contract that gives him the right to move to another club.
“We are incredibly disappointed that Steven has chosen a different direction than the one we had set out on together, but we respect his choice. He is incredibly well-liked at the club, so I am sure he will miss us, just as we will also miss him,” says head coach Joey Gudjonsson.
25-year-old Simpson joined the club in August 2024 from Esbjerg fB with three goals and three assists in 27 games.
“Steven’s departure comes unexpectedly. We had spoken to him lately, where he had reaffirmed his commitment to us. We told him that we intended to keep the core of the team and the starting eleven players in the coming season,” says sports director Jen Chang. “Nevertheless, Steven has chosen to make use of his clause in the contract, and we are sad to see him leave AB. We thank him for all his hard work in the past season.”
Steven Simpson wishes the club the best of luck in the coming season.
“It is a spontaneous decision to leave AB, and I did not expect to leave the club so quickly. I would like to thank everyone in AB. I will miss the locker room, the staff and a superb fan base filled with a lot of amazing people. I look forward to following the development in AB, and wish the club all the best next season,” says Steven Simpson.
